My BMW XM's adaptive cruise control keeps malfunctioning. Sometimes it works fine, but other times it doesn't respond at all or slows down unexpectedly. What could be causing this issue and how can I fix it?
ReplyIt sounds like there could be a problem with the sensors or the programming. Try checking the sensors for any damage or debris and make sure they are properly calibrated. If that doesn't help, you may need to bring your car to a BMW dealership for further diagnosis and repair.
Have you recently had any work done on your car, like a tire change or alignment? Sometimes those types of services can affect the adaptive cruise control settings. It's always a good idea to double check and recalibrate after any major maintenance.
Another common issue with adaptive cruise control is a low battery. Make sure your car's battery is fully charged and in good condition. If it's been a while since you got it replaced, it might be time for a new one.
